Chronic fatigue condition can be debilitating, often leaving individuals feeling drained and unable to perform everyday functions. A growing body of research points to mitochondrial dysfunction as a key factor in the occurrence of this frustrating illness. These tiny powerhouses within our cells are responsible for energy production, and when they aren't working optimally, fatigue becomes a persistent problem. Therefore, a strategic supplementation approach targeting mitochondrial function may be vital to improving chronic fatigue effects. This isn't about a quick fix; it's about supporting the body's inherent potential to heal and restore energy levels. Below we will explore some beneficial supplements, keeping in mind that individual responses change and consultation with a qualified professional is always recommended before commencing any new program.
Potential Supplements to Consider:
- CoQ10: Essential for mitochondrial electron transport, helping to boost energy performance.
- PQQ (Pyrroloquinoline Quinone): Supports mitochondrial biogenesis – the creation of new mitochondria.
- D-Ribose: A carbohydrate that aids in ATP production, the cellular fuel source.
- Alpha-Lipoic Acid (ALA): Acts as an antioxidant and promotes mitochondrial function, also involved in energy processing.
- Creatine: While often associated with muscle performance, it can also support brain energy and mitochondrial activity.
- NADH: A coenzyme directly involved in cellular processes; supplementing may improve energy production.
Remember, addressing chronic fatigue is a integrated journey, involving diet, lifestyle modifications, and addressing underlying issues. Supplementation is just one piece of the puzzle, and should be used under the guidance of a knowledgeable healthcare provider.

Boosting Chronic Fatigue & Mitochondria's: Potential Strategies
Chronic fatigue syndrome (CFS), also known as myalgic encephalomyelitis (ME), is a debilitating condition frequently linked to compromised mitochondrial performance. These powerhouses are responsible for generating cellular energy, and when they aren't working efficiently, it can lead to the pervasive lethargy and other symptoms characteristic of CFS. While no single supplement is a guaranteed cure, several vitamins show promise in supporting mitochondrial health and potentially alleviating some of the burden of chronic fatigue. Looking into options such as CoQ10, which plays a crucial role in the electron transport chain; L-Carnitine, involved in fatty acid metabolism and energy creation; and Alpha-Lipoic Acid (ALA), a powerful antioxidant that can enhance mitochondrial efficiency are worth discussing. Furthermore, certain B nutrients, magnesium, and D-Ribose may also contribute to cellular support. Importantly remember that it’s essential to consult with a qualified healthcare professional before initiating any new regimen, as individual needs and responses can differ significantly, and existing medications may interact.
